Benign Fasiculations or?....

by Phoebe32, Jan 21, 2008 01:39PM
I'm a 33 year old female who's been suffering from muscle twitches, mostly in the soles of my feet for 7 years now. (since 2001) I occasionally get the twitches in my arms, legs, tongue, cheeks, jaw, etc, and also now frequently get them in my  hands. I've had 3 emgs over the course of 6 years, and all were normal.
Several months ago I had another emg to see how things were going, and the neurologist noted that the exam was "normal" with the exception of isolated increased amplitude in the right foot sole and also "polyphasia". I also had "upgoing toes" upon clinical exam. He told me that everything is fine but I did research on what was found and according to everything I've read, increased amplitude, polyphasia and a positive babinski indicate a neurological disorder. My question is, are these ever findings associated with Benign Fasiculation Syndrome?, or should I go back and talk with the doctor or see another doctor regarding the emg findings? Are these signs of early ALS?
